- 75TV Guide MagazineTV Guide MagazineDirector Joan Freeman, who cowrote the screenplay with her husband, Robert Alden, shows a remarkable talent for capturing the sights and sounds of this seamy world. Freeman works a gritty realism into the formula story, creating an always-fascinating tale from an ugly subject.
- 70The New York TimesJanet MaslinThe New York TimesJanet MaslinStreetwalkin' isn't exactly full of surprises. But it certainly moves.
- 50Los Angeles TimesKevin ThomasLos Angeles TimesKevin ThomasMake no mistake about it: Streetwalkin’ (a very hard R) is first and foremost a blood bath.
- 20Time OutTime OutStarting off as lurid, documentary-style melodrama before it settles into an over-extended and often risible cat-and-mouse chase, this witless pile of prurient sleaze is poorly paced and saddled with a predictable script, stereotype characterisations, and distastefully voyeuristic direction.
